Comment 11 for bug 1906565

Revision history for this message
Brian Murray (brian-murray) wrote :

I installed the version of apport from xenial-proposed and no longer received a Traceback when running the test case.

Preparing to unpack .../python3-apport_2.20.1-0ubuntu2.28_all.deb ...
Unpacking python3-apport (2.20.1-0ubuntu2.28) over (2.20.1-0ubuntu2.27) ...
Preparing to unpack .../apport_2.20.1-0ubuntu2.28_all.deb ...
Unpacking apport (2.20.1-0ubuntu2.28) over (2.20.1-0ubuntu2.27) ...
Processing triggers for man-db (2.7.5-1) ...
Processing triggers for hicolor-icon-theme (0.15-0ubuntu1.1) ...
Processing triggers for systemd (229-4ubuntu21.29) ...
Processing triggers for ureadahead (0.100.0-19.1) ...
Setting up python3-apport (2.20.1-0ubuntu2.28) ...
Setting up apport (2.20.1-0ubuntu2.28) ...
bdmurray@clean-xenial-amd64:~$ python3 generate-sigsegv-crash.py cat
GNU gdb (Ubuntu 7.11.1-0ubuntu1~16.5) 7.11.1
Copyright (C) 2016 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law. Type "show copying"
and "show warranty" for details.
This GDB was configured as "x86_64-linux-gnu".
Type "show configuration" for configuration details.
For bug reporting instructions, please see:
<http://www.gnu.org/software/gdb/bugs/>.
Find the GDB manual and other documentation resources online at:
<http://www.gnu.org/software/gdb/documentation/>.
For help, type "help".
Type "apropos word" to search for commands related to "word"...
Reading symbols from cat...(no debugging symbols found)...done.
(gdb) Starting program: /bin/cat

Program received signal SIGSEGV, Segmentation fault.
0x00007ffff7b04320 in __read_nocancel () at ../sysdeps/unix/syscall-template.S:84
84 ../sysdeps/unix/syscall-template.S: No such file or directory.
(gdb) Saved corefile /tmp/tmplo7od5en/my.core
(gdb) ERROR: apport (pid 2923) Fri Dec 4 15:48:31 2020: called for pid 2915, signal 11, core limit 0, dump mode 1
ERROR: apport (pid 2923) Fri Dec 4 15:48:31 2020: executable: /bin/cat (command line "/bin/cat")
ERROR: apport (pid 2923) Fri Dec 4 15:48:31 2020: is_closing_session(): no DBUS_SESSION_BUS_ADDRESS in environment
ERROR: apport (pid 2923) Fri Dec 4 15:48:31 2020: wrote report /tmp/tmplo7od5en/_bin_cat.1000.crash
(gdb) Kill the program being debugged? (y or n) [answered Y; input not from terminal]
(gdb) --- post-processing /tmp/tmplo7od5en/_bin_cat.1000.crash